John T. West, Jr., passed away peacefully, surrounded by family, on August 15, 2025, in Mishawaka, Indiana, after a life filled with humor, resilience, and memorable moments. Born December 9, 1966, in South Bend, Indiana, John carried the spirit of his hometown with him throughout his life.

John had an unmatched passion for the Chicago Bears and the Chicago White Sox. His game-day enthusiasm was well known, and his spirited commentary was a staple during every season. Off the field, John was a talented cook whose spaghetti, chicken gravy and rice, and grilling skills became the centerpiece of many gatherings.

John was a proud father and grandfather. He is survived by his children, LaQuita (Robert) West-Hogan, LaToya West, and Sierra Seibert, and his grandchildren, Zymari, Zakai, Zyiah, Zayah, and Nova Marie. Though his path through parenthood was not always conventional, his presence remained a part of the family story.

John joins in eternal rest his parents, John Sr. and Lula Bell West, and his siblings Mark West, Jason West, Dianna Hubbard-Fultz and Robert Williams. As well as his aunts and uncles Billie Wesley, Laura Grey, Sarah Long, Jake Long, Inobia "Sweet" Baker, Laura McDonald, Rev. Booker T. West, Arthur West, James West, Evelyn Coppage and George Long. He is remembered by his sisters Deborah West, Charlotte Ottbridge, Shannon (Marcus) Jackson, Nicole Ford, and his brother Craig (Kathy) West, a special sister Yvette West and special nephew Sedelle Blue. His extended family of nieces, nephews, and friends will continue to share his stories and remember his spirit.

John found peace in the quiet of nature, particularly while fishing - a hobby that offered him both solitude and joy. He valued the simple pleasures in life and had a strong sense of independence that defined his journey.

Condolences, photos, and memories may be shared with the family at www.BrownFuneralHomeNiles.com. A celebration of life will take place on August 23, 2025, at Brown Funeral Home at 12 p.m., with visitation beginning at 11:00 a.m.

As we remember John T. West, Jr., we reflect on a life lived on his own terms - one marked by unique passions, enduring traditions, and moments that shaped those around him. He leaves behind a legacy of authenticity and strength, and his memory will live on in the hearts of those who knew him.
